Am Freitag, 26. August 2005 08:15 CEST schrieb Emanuel Strobl:
> Hello,
>
> fortunately I had my laptop logging on the serial console when my box
> suddenly panicked.
> I just removed a directory, no usual panic message. System is late
> BETA2, please find attached the trace and panick message

This panic showed up again, again after the same things done, so I filed a=
=20
PR: http://www.freebsd.org/cgi/query-pr.cgi?pr=3D85804
Unfortunately I can't reproduce it with a freshly booted machine, seems the=
=20
box hast to be up some days....
Again, attached all I got on the serial console this time.

panic: handle_workitem_remove: bad file delta
KDB: enter: panic
[thread pid 54 tid 100059 ]
Stopped at      kdb_enter+0x30: leave  =20
db> where
Tracing pid 54 tid 100059 td 0xc1e75780
kdb_enter(c0791b35,c0801560,c07a421e,d58b2c3c,100) at kdb_enter+0x30
panic(c07a421e,11970,0,d58b2c50,3b7) at panic+0xd5
handle_workitem_remove(c2d81de0,0,2,32e,0) at handle_workitem_remove+0x107
process_worklist_item(0,0,c07a39e1,2de,431db271) at process_worklist_item+0=
x20b
softdep_process_worklist(0,0,c079a93a,678,0) at softdep_process_worklist+0x=
130
sched_sync(0,d58b2d38,c078ef39,30d,0) at sched_sync+0x2ee
fork_exit(c06078c0,0,d58b2d38) at fork_exit+0xc1
fork_trampoline() at fork_trampoline+0x8
=2D-- trap 0x1, eip =3D 0, esp =3D 0xd58b2d6c, ebp =3D 0 ---
